-eae A suffix added to the stem of a generic name to form the name of a tribe, e.g. Aster → Astereae. ebracteate Lacking bracts; synonymous with ebracteolate. ecological amplitude The range of environmental conditions in which an organism can survive. edaphic Of or influenced by the soil. elaiosome An external structure attached to the seed of many species of plants. Web9 Dec 2024 · The name is derived from “Izor” or “Jur,” a vernacular Arabic word for rose. The flowers of Ixora plants generally grow in clusters at the end of branches, which may be either upright or hanging down. WebInflorescence derives from the Latin verb inflorescere, meaning "to begin to bloom," and ultimately from florēre, "to blossom" or "to flourish." Generally, it refers to the arrangement of flowers on the stem or stalk of a plant.
